Summary:
Staff is requesting approval to initiate Growth Management Plan (GMP) amendments for the 2019 Winter Cycle of amendments. Once initiated, the City Planning Division will prepare staff reports and schedule each case for review by the Municipal Planning Board. The amendments will then be scheduled for consideration by City Council at a public hearing (first reading of the ordinance) in December 2018, with adoption (second reading) of the amendments in January or February of 2019.
The following City-initiated Growth Management Plan (GMP) Amendments are proposed:
Future Land Use Element
- 9197 Boggy Creek Road - Future Land Use map amendment to change 5.3 acres of land in an existing conservation easement from Office Low Intensity to Conservation in coordination with the applicant's request for approval of a master plan for warehouse development on the remainder of the property.
Historic Preservation Element - Add recently designated historic landmarks:
- Davis Armory
- Municipal Auditorium/Bob Carr Theatre
- H. Carl Dann House
- Marsh House (Eola House)
- Pappy Kennedy Residence
- William Doerr Residence
Future Land Use and Historic Preservation Elements - Add policies in support of creating "Historic Conservation Districts" or something similar in the Land Development Code. Such districts are intended to preserve the character of existing neighborhoods, without requiring full review as historic structures.
Transportation Element – Update Transportation Figures 26, 28, 41, 44, 46, 48, 49, 49A, 50, 51, and 52 to reflect new transportation data and analysis.
Recreation & Open Space Element - Update Recreation Figure R-1B Park LOS Summary Table to depict Existing and Projected Acreage Capacity as of June 30, 2018. |
